I purchased an Acer Aspire laptop from Curry's today and when I looked at it in the shop the size of the screen didn't seem hat large given that it was a 15.6" screen.

Only when I got the laptop home, I discovered that close up it was far too big for what I'm needing a laptop for. I've had a look at Curry's returns policy and it states that items can be returned in their 'Original and Unopened Packaging.'

I'm more that happy for Curry's to exchange the laptop for a smaller screen size as I do need a laptop, but seeing as their returns policy states the above, am I just going to have to lump it and stay with the laptop I've bought?

    Because you bought in a shop you have no rights to return for the reasons you state, however first stop must surely be to go back and ask them nicely?

    They have no legal obligation to accept your return due to a change of mind. As you say you'll just have to lump it I'm afraid. You'll soon get used to the size, and in fact you'll probably be glad for it.
